Description
A vibrant and easy Garlic Herb Roasted Salmon dish that impresses with its simplicity and flavor, enriched with garlic, herbs, and a splash of orange.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lb Salmon Fillet
- 1/4 cup Parmesan cheese (grated)
- 1 tbsp fresh parsley (chopped)
- 3 tbsp fresh dill
- 4 tbsp unsalted butter (softened)
- 1/4 cup orange juice
- 1 tbsp garlic parsley salt (adjust to taste)
- 3 garlic cloves (minced)
Instructions
- In a medium-sized bowl, combine parmesan cheese, parsley, dill, butter, garlic, garlic parsley salt, and orange juice.
-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il and place salmon fillets on top.
- Top off each piece with a hefty spoon of your herb garlic butter.
- Bake salmon at 415°F for about 15 minutes until the fish flakes apart easily and reaches an internal temperature of 145°F.
- Serve immediately and enjoy!
Notes
Use fresh herbs for the best flavor; marinate the salmon for added depth.
